So our first night we made our Grey Stuff Pie. It’s quite easy to make and just takes time to set.

The ingredients are pretty simple. 2 boxes Oreo pudding mix, 1 Oreo pie crust, 2 ½ cups milk, extra Oreos to crush up. Mix everything up, pour into crust, put in fridge or freezer to set. Top with whipped cream. As you can see, we had big fun making it. After making the pie we watched the movie.

Okay Experienced Dis Mommies this is where your votes get important. I need to start planning how I am going to make our stroller stand out in the masses so that means that we need to lock down and decide which one we are bringing with us. Here are our options:


9b4ebc37-522a-4ce1-9143-7416a9acd8fd_zpsaadbf9a2.jpg

Option 1: The Jogging Stroller

Pros:
- Wonderful Maneuverability
- The Sun shade moves and can pretty much block out the sun at every angle.
-Larger cup holders up top (still small but at least our water bottles fit)


Cons:
-The basket underneath is not quiet big enough to hold our park backpack in a way that we can still easily access what’s inside.
-Must fully recline the chair BEFORE it can be collapsed
-Hard to get folded (I can never manage it.)
- Folds in half downwards so is very bulky once folded.




20150120_155954_zpsrbmtejtz.jpg

Option 2: The old Standby

Pros:
- MUCH larger basket plenty of room for our backpack to sit with room for quick grab out of it.
-Quick and easy fold
-Folds Flat when collapsed
- The flat folding will make it slightly easier to pack into the car with everything else
- Easy Adjustable handle so that DH and I can change the height of it in a blink.

Cons:
-Maneuverability can get tricky over rough terrain
-The Shade visor is attached to the back of the stroller so can only adjust so far
- Can be a little harder in large crowds
- I remember seeing at least 2-3 of these on our last trip in ‘13
-Smaller cup holders can't quite fit anything but a small water bottle



So Dis Mommies Which would you go with and any suggestions on making it easier to spot in the crowd?
